Unveiling the Mechanisms of Soursop's Cancer-Fighting Potential
Soursop, a tropical fruit with a creamy texture and a unique flavor profile, has gained attention in recent years for its purported medicinal properties. While traditional uses of soursop have been observed for centuries, clinical studies are now shedding light on the potential of this fruit to combat cancer.
One of the key compounds responsible for soursop's cancer-inhibiting properties is acetogenin. Acetogenins are a class of natural chemicals found in various plants, including soursop, that have shown promising results in laboratory settings against different types of cancer cells. These molecules work by interfering with cell division, ultimately leading to programmed cell death.
Research suggests that soursop's acetogenins may target specific enzymes involved in cancer cell survival. They have also been shown to induce oxidative stress, a process that can damage cancer cells.
Furthermore, soursop contains other bioactive molecules, such as flavonoids and tannins, which may contribute to its tumor-suppressive properties. These compounds possess antioxidant and protective properties that can help defend the body against cancer.
While the research on soursop's anti-cancer effects is still in its early stages, the preliminary findings are encouraging. However, it is important to note that soursop should not be considered a substitute for conventional cancer treatments.
